Output 3c103d3640825dae2a82dd0966be25cb398f2aef0e252e690c7337e9f3424944:7

value
118213262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d59deee6be7af8ae3274a669ff7a5600863a8a9b OP_EQUALVERIFY OP_CHECKSIG
address
1LUW8FbJ4QeHDzsPEtsCZ989zT74ywVbjq
transaction
3c103d3640825dae2a82dd0966be25cb398f2aef0e252e690c7337e9f3424944
spent
true